How I Check the Number of Outlets

One of the first things I look at is how many outlets the power strip provides. I always think about how many devices I need to plug in at once. For my desk, I may need outlets for a laptop, monitor, charger, and lamp. If I am setting one up near my TV, I consider the console, streaming device, sound system, and more. I like to choose a strip with a few extra outlets so I do not run out later.

Why Surge Protection Matters to Me

I never ignore surge protection. In my experience, this is one of the most important features, especially when I am plugging in electronics that I value. A power strip with surge protection can help guard my devices against sudden power spikes. I always check the joule rating because it gives me an idea of how much protection I am getting.

What I Look for in Cord Quality

The cord is a big deal for me. Since I am specifically looking for a 6 foot power strip, I want the cord to be durable, flexible, and thick enough to handle regular use. I also pay attention to whether the plug is low-profile, since that can make it easier to fit behind furniture. In my experience, a strong cord makes the whole product feel more reliable.

How I Decide Between Basic and USB Models

Sometimes I choose a standard power strip, and other times I prefer one with USB ports. If I charge my phone, tablet, or wireless earbuds often, I find USB ports very convenient. They save outlet space and reduce the number of adapters I need. Still, if I mainly need AC outlets, I may go with a simpler model. I decide based on what I actually use every day.

Why Safety Features Matter to My Choice

I always check for safety features before buying. Things like overload protection, fire-resistant materials, and a reset switch give me more confidence. If I plan to use the strip in a busy area or around expensive electronics, I want it to feel safe and dependable. For me, a good power strip should not just be convenient—it should also help protect my home and devices.

How I Think About Build Quality and Design

I prefer a power strip that feels sturdy and well made. If the outlets are spaced too tightly, I know larger plugs may block each other, so I look for enough spacing between sockets. I also like a design that works well on a desk or floor without looking bulky. In my experience, a practical layout makes everyday use much easier.
